A bill to provide for the temporary transfer of the hospital ship United States ship Sanctuary (AH-17) to LIFE International for the purpose of providing health care and related services to developing nations on a nonprofit basis, and to authorize funds for such purpose.
SS Life Act - Directs the Secretary of the Navy to transfer to LIFE International for 15 years the hospital ship U.S.S. Sanctuary (AH-17) to furnish health care to developing nations. Renames such ship the "SS LIFE".
Authorizes the appropriation of $6,000,000 for fiscal year 1979 for modification of such ship and for maintenance and operation $494,000 for fiscal year 1979, $5,000,000 for fiscal year 1980, $4,000,000 for fiscal year 1981, $3,000,000 for fiscal year 1982, $2,000,000 for fiscal year 1983, and $1,000,000 for fiscal year 1984.
